Attribute dimensions

Attribute dimensions are dimensions associated with standard dimensions. Attribute dimensions are useful in describing a standard dimension member's attributes. For example, in our Esscar database, we have the Vehicles dimension. If we wanted to differentiate between a two or four door car of the same model, we could use an attribute dimension to accomplish this. We could also use an attribute dimension to track color.

Note

Attribute dimensions are always dynamically calculated, which means they do not store the data. This is always a benefit as they do not affect the size or performance of the database.

Attribute dimensions must always be associated with a standard dimension.
